George Josimovich, Max Kahn, Eleanor Coen, Mario Ubaldi, Emmanuel Viviano, and Freeman Schoolcraft

May 07 – June 16, 1943

 
 
The Renaissance Society of the University of Chicago invites members and their guests to the opening of an exhibition of

paintings in oil by
George Josimovich
watercolors and guaches by
Max Kahn
Color lithographs by
Eleanor Coen
Sculpture by
Mario Ubaldi
Emmanuel Viviano

and
Freeman Schoolcraft


Friday evening, May 7, from 8:00 until 10:00 P.M.
Refreshments
The exhibition will be open to the public through June 16, daily except Sunday, 9:00 A.M. to 12:00 M. after June 1
108 Goodspeed Hall 1012 East 59th Street
